Logitech Launches New MetroFi Earphones

Logitech has announced additions to its MetroFi line of Ultimate Ears earphones - MetroFi 170 and MetroFi 200.

Ultimate Ears by Logitech earphones deliver customized comfort by creating a "magic" seal between your ear and the outside world, limiting ambient noise. Both the MetroFi 170s and the 200s provide 16 dBs of noise isolation.
MetroFi noise-isolating earphones use silicone ear-cushions that are soft enough to conform to the unique shape of the ear canal, yet strong enough to help create exceptionally accurate sound quality.
You get three silicone ear-cushions to choose from ensuring you find a fit that makes the MetroFi 170 or the MetroFi 200 earphones perfect for you.
Featuring a titanium-coated speaker that delivers a crisp sound signature, the MetroFi 200 earphones give a fuller mix with more detail in the higher-frequency range for deeper bass and clear treble.
The 170s and 200s also include a red-colored right earphone to help you distinguish between left and right earphones. A pocket-sized carrying case is also bundled.
All MetroFi earphones are compatible with any iPod digital device, MP3 player or laptop with a 3.5 mm jack.
The MetroFi 170 and the MetroFi 200 earphones are available in iPhone- and BlackBerry- compatible models - with voice-integrated technology. For handsfree calling, the MetroFi 170vi and MetroFi 200vi earphones offer a miniature high-performance microphone that lets you switch between making calls and enjoying music and video on your iPhone or BlackBerry.
